Archie Comics has been publishing original comic adaptions of Sonic the Hedgehog (or SatAM), Knuckles the Echidna, Sonic X and an original title called Sonic Universe. All the comics are officially sponsored by Sega and are ongoing. Sonic the Hedgehog and Sonic Universe are still running, but Knuckles the Echidna and Sonic X have ended.

Archie Comics carried the Comics Code Authority (CCA) seal, however it was removed in February 2011 in favor of self-regulation of content. The CCA is a ratings authority which was established in the 1950s amid a witch hunt that targeted the comic book industry. Led by psychiatrist Frederick Werthem, the industry reacted by setting up the CCA to regulate itself and censor questionable content. This regulation nearly destroyed the industry and has since become more lacks over the years. Archie Comics was one of the few companies that continued to use the CCA stamp on all of its publications, and no longer currently does so.

Sonic Comic Series

Sonic the Hedgehog

Published since 1993 and currently ongoing, it was heavily inspired by the American Sonic the Hedgehog cartoon and contains many characters from that series in its storyline along with many Archie exclusive characters as well as game characters. Occasionally, they are combined with actual cartoon or game adaptions, with the former tending to be non-canon side stories.

Knuckles the Echidna

Starting as a mini-series called Knuckles the Dark Legion, Archie decided to extend it into an ongoing series called Knuckles the Echidna which lasted a total of 32 issues. These comics were written by Ken Penders. These comics starred Knuckles and Julie-Su the Echidna resulting in a lot of sexual tension until after the series ended and the two finally got together.

Sonic X

The comics have been in existence since the end of at least the first Sonic X series. The majority of the series involves real-life relations or other Sonic games that tie into the main storyline of the games. In response to the fan letters, Archie writers have stated that the comic series takes place between the second and third seasons (so after the Sonic Adventure 1 and 2 adaptations, but before the gang returns to their unnamed homeworld). The series had 40 total issues. The last issue notably featured a crossover with the regular Sonic the Hedgehog series involving Shadow and Metal Sonic from that universe.

Sonic Universe

After the Sonic X comic was cancelled it was replaced by a spin off series called Sonic Universe which picked up right after its predecessor. The series is made up of 4-issue story arcs that are able to explore characters and locations not necessary in the main book. The arcs were also created with trade paperbacks in mind (see graphic novel section below).

Story Arcs

  • Issues 1-4: The Shadow Saga (aka The Ultimate Lifeform)
  • Issues 5-8: Mobius: 30 Years Later
  • Issues 9-12: Knuckles: The Return (aka Echoes From the Past)
  • Issues 13-16: Journey to the East
  • Issues 17-20: The Tails Adventure (aka Trouble in Paradise)
  • Issues 21-24: Treasure Team Tango
  • Issues 25-28: The Silver Saga (aka Fractured Mirror)
  • Issues 29-32: Scourge: Lockdown (aka Inside Job)

Other Sonic Series

Along with these ongoing series' Archie also produced 5 mini-series' (Sonic the Hedgehog, Princess Sally, Tails, Knuckles the Echidna and Sonic Quest). Archie also produced 8 special issues many of which were adaptations of video games. 15 more specials were made under the title of Sonic Super Special. Archie also produces special issues of Sonic the Hedgehog for Free Comic Book day from 2007-2011.

Sonic Trade Paperbacks

Throughout the run of the Sonic comics Archie has produced many individual graphic novels as well as several series, each reprinting past issues or stories.

  • Sonic Firsts (originally published as Sonic Super Special Issue 3
  • Sonic: The Beginning, reprinting the original 4 issue Sonic miniseries
  • Sonic Archives, (beginning with a reprint of Sonic: The Beginning as Volume 0), collects the Sonic the Hedgehog series from issue 1, 4 issues each (Volume 13 contains 2 issues, one in its Sonic Super Special directors cut form as well as 2 more stories from the Sonic Super Specials).
  • Sonic Select, reprinting canon stories from the Sonic Specials, Sonic Super Specials, and various Sonic miniseries
  • Knuckles Archives: Reprints the Knuckles the Echidna issues, 6 per volume. The first volume contains the Knuckles miniseries as well as the first 3 issues of the Knuckles series.
  • Sonic Legacy: Each volume reprints 16 issues of the Sonic the Hedgehog series in a cheaper, more affordable format--black and white.
  • Sonic Universe: Collects one 4 issue story arc from Sonic Universe per volume.
  • Sonic: Genesis: A hardcover book which collects the Genesis saga from the Sonic series, meaning issues 226-229.

Trivia

  • Both Sonic the Hedgehog and Sonic X started with a four-issue mini-series to see if the series would gain much popularity. Later issues state connections to them as part of the main storyline. NiGHTS and Knuckles the Echidna also had a 3-issue adaption-- twice. Unfortunately, NiGHTS fell, but the second Knuckles series became an ongoing comic.
  • Sonic, Sally, Tails, and Knuckles had their own mini-series.
  • Sonic X, though closer in canonicity to the games, does not have a comic adaptions of any of the games.
